What is Long COVID?

Long COVID is a fatiguing illness that limits my ability to think, walk, talk, work, work out, or take part in everyday activities like showering and feeding myself.

In addition to the physical limitations of Long COVID, I also struggle with debilitating cognitive issues. The doctors are referring to this form of brain inflammation as Mild Cognitive Impairment. The symptoms mirror the symptoms of early-onset Alzheimer’s.

Tell me about the surgery!

This will be a two-year process that starts with a palate expansion to widen my nose and ends with a double jaw surgery to keep my tongue from falling into my throat when I sleep.

Check out this cool digital mould of my palate. You can see how narrow and high it is. Changing this will allow me to breathe through my nose!

This series of procedures has a very high chance of completely curing my sleep apnea, which could significantly improve my chances of recovering from Long COVID. Worst-case scenario: it improves my long-term and overall health, but I continue to live life close to home.
